Hi - been researching the sleeve for myself, I am also self-pay. - I live in NE Ohio but am from Cincinnati originally. Up this way - Cleveland Clinic, Akron docs - self pay - 18500-21000. Have you checked with Dr Trace Curry in Cincinnati? Last fall when I was checking - I believe I was told 14-15000 for self pay.

The costs were astronomical here in Rochester MN at the Mayo Clinic, so I am traveling to Dallas TX for my sleeve surgery. It will cost $13000 (with airfare for my husband and me). I know it might be cheaper in Mexico, but my husband and I weren't comfortable with that option.

Self pay sleeve in the states is going to run you at least 15G. Mexico would be under 10. I had a full virgin DS for 13 in Hermasillo with Ungson. As long as you research and go with a repetuable surgeon, you are fine.
My surgery included 5 days hotel, 4 days hospital, surgeon, asst surgeon, internist, anes. sp?, private nurse, private hospital. Most the more common hospital in Mexico are going to have self pay packages which is a benefit to them. They are used to Americans and ask how they handle it. Go with someone. Ungson usually has at least 3 Americans a week. So I was very comfortable. I don't suggest going through a medical tourism group, I suggest going with a surgeon that has his own patient coordinator.
